Triston McKenzie is making his first start of the season as the Cleveland Guardians (26-32) face off against the Minnesota Twins (31-28) at Target Field on Sunday with the visitors looking to split the four-game series.

The Guardians won 4-2 on Saturday for their first win of the series, their third head-to-head victory in six games this season. Starter Logan Allen went six innings, giving up two runs on seven hits, to get the win, and Emmanuel Clase earned his 18th save with a scoreless ninth.

Andres Gimenez was 3 for 4 with a double and one run in the win. Christian Vazquez went 1 for 2 with a double and one run for the Twins.

ON THE MOUND

McKenzie is in line to take the mound for Cleveland, his season debut. Last season, the RHP made 30 starts and went 11-11 with a 2.96 ERA. He had 190 strikeouts and 44 walks over 191.1 innings.

Over five starts against the Twins in 2022, McKenzie was 1-2 with a 5.46 ERA over 31.1 innings. He had 29 strikeouts and six walks. For Minnesota, RHP Joe Ryan (7-2, 2.77 ERA) will toe the rubber. He has made one prior start against the Guardians this season, giving up two runs over six innings in a 2-0 road defeat on May 7.

He gave up eight hits while striking out four in the loss. In his last start on Tuesday, Ryan took the loss on the road against the Astros. He threw four innings and gave up five runs on four hits, striking out six and walking three in the 5-1 defeat. The right-hander is tied for second in the AL in wins.

AT THE PLATE

Over the last five games, Cleveland has averaged 5.4 runs a game, up from their season average of 3.6, while slashing better across the board (.305/.350/.444). Against righties like Ryan this season, the Guardians have a .646 OPS, third lowest in the league.

Jose Ramirez is the team’s strongest hitter against right-handers with a .869 OPS in 148 at-bats. Minnesota is averaging only 3.8 runs per game in the last five, down slightly from 4.5 for the season.

The Twins have a .730 OPS against right-handers in 2023. With a .871 OPS over 110 at-bats, Joey Gallo has been their best hitter against right-handers.

HOME AND AWAY

Cleveland is 14-17 away from Progressive Field in 2023, scoring 4.4 runs per game while allowing 4.5 runs. Minnesota has gone 18-13 at Target Field this season, averaging 4.7 runs per game while surrendering 3.8. Cleveland is 6-4 in the last 10 meetings at Target Field with an average scoreline of 4.5-4.0.

STANDINGS UPDATE

The Twins lead the AL Central by three games over the Tigers. The Guardians are third in the AL Central, four games behind the Twins.
